Kyle Curtis Dicken, of Poplar Bluff, passed away, Sunday, January 8, 2012, at the age of 16.
Kyle was born October 31, 1995, in Honolulu, Hawaii. He was a lifetime resident of Butler County, and was a student at the Poplar Bluff High School. He attended the Fellowship Southern Baptist Church and the First Baptist Church, where he was a member of the orchestra. He loved playing in the school band, his trombone and tuba, video games, fishing, camping and hunting.
Kyle is survived by his father James Curtis "J.C." Dicken, (Rebecca Cox), of Poplar Bluff, his mother, Lenette (Blackwell) Hendrix and step-father Sheldon Hendrix, of Poplar Bluff; grandparents, Curtis and Wanda Dicken of Poplar Bluff, grandmothers, Terry Callender, of Granite City, Ill. and Linda Pickens, Poplar Bluff; 2 sisters, Megan Pulliam and Taylor Praefke, both of Poplar Bluff; brothers, Eric Cobb, Cody Hendrix and Triston Campbell, all of Poplar Bluff; 2 nieces, Nicole Hendrix, Marlie Hendrix and one cousin, Mallory Dicken; uncle Bobby Dicken and wife Jamie.
He is preceded in death by his brother, Dylane Eugene Campbell.
Visitation for Kyle will start at 6 p.m., Wednesday, January 11, 2012 at the First Baptist Church in Poplar Bluff. Funeral services will be at 12 p.m. (noon) Thursday, January 12, 2012 at the church, with Dr. William Vail and Student Pastor Dave McCormack officiating. Burial will be in the Dicken Cemetery.
